Output d57ddcd95d70b0ab1a96314c9e686163768ef9771857d31bf31725ffdf263b1f:0

value
22675405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e580ffe5deff6ae34e7eef9441114c9694c83a24 OP_EQUAL
address
MUpfWQfQd9Cq2UbWu5XZPsnk2j2RiEQ6gR
transaction
d57ddcd95d70b0ab1a96314c9e686163768ef9771857d31bf31725ffdf263b1f
spent
true